Supplement Facts
| Ingredient | Amount | % DV |
|---|---|---|
| Vitamin A (as beta-carotene) | 900 mcg RAE | 100% |
| Vitamin C (as ascorbic acid) | 150 mg | 167% |
| Vitamin D3 (as cholecalciferol) | 15 mcg (600 IU) | 75% |
| Vitamin E (as d-alpha tocopheryl succinate) | 15 mg (22.4 IU) | 100% |
| Vitamin B1 (as thiamin mononitrate) | 10 mg | 833% |
| Vitamin B2 (as riboflavin) | 10 mg | 769% |
| Vitamin B3 (as niacinamide) | 40 mg | 250% |
| Vitamin B6 (as pyridoxine hydrochloride) | 10 mg | 588% |
| Folate (400 mcg folic acid) | 667 mcg DFE | 167% |
| Vitamin B12 (as methylcobalamin) | 30 mcg | 1,250% |
| Biotin (as d-biotin) | 300 mcg | 1,000% |
| Pantothenic Acid (as d-calcium pantothenate) | 10 mg | 200% |
| Calcium (as calcium carbonate) | 25 mg | 2% |
| Magnesium (as magnesium oxide) | 50 mg | 12% |
| Zinc (as zinc oxide) | 15 mg | 136% |
| Selenium (as selenium glycinate) | 40 mcg | 73% |
| Copper (as copper gluconate) | 0.9 mg | 100% |
| Manganese (as manganese amino acid chelate) | 1 mg | 43% |
| Chromium (as chromium picolinate) | 35 mcg | 100% |
| Molybdenum (as molybdenum glycinate chelate) | 100 mcg | 222% |

Is NatureWise Multivitamin for Men a good supplement?
NatureWise Multivitamin for Men received a product quality score of 88/100 in GoodSupp's independent analysis, indicating strong overall quality. The product contains 20 active ingredients with 30 servings per container. Of the 4 inactive ingredients, 2 are rated safe and 0 are flagged for review. The manufacturer, NatureWise, holds a brand trust score of 81/100 with 4 verified certifications including Consumerlab, Fda Gmp Inspections, Nsf Gmp, Usda Organic.

Is NatureWise a trustworthy supplement brand?
NatureWise receives a brand trust score of 81/100 based on GoodSupp's independent analysis of certifications, regulatory history, and transparency practices. Founded in 2012 and headquartered in Ashland, Oregon, USA, the company offers 35 products in their lineup. They hold 4 verified certifications including Consumerlab, Fda Gmp Inspections, Nsf Gmp, Usda Organic. Third-party certifications are independently verified and indicate the brand meets specific quality, purity, and manufacturing standards. Note: NatureWise has 3 historical regulatory incidents on record, which are factored into the trust score.
How much vitamin d3 should i take daily?
The optimal dosage depends on your individual health needs, age, sex, and current nutrient levels. Recommended daily amounts are established by health authorities but may vary from therapeutic doses used in clinical research. It's important to check the Supplement Facts label for the exact amount per serving and compare it against the % Daily Value. Some supplements provide mega-doses well above the Daily Value, which may not be necessary and in some cases could be harmful — particularly for fat-soluble vitamins (A, D, E, K) that accumulate in the body.
